Business owners in Hillsborough County have the opportunity to apply for disaster loans until January 7. The Small Business Administration (SBA) has resumed processing these loans, providing crucial financial assistance to those affected by recent disasters.
The application process takes place at the Business Recovery Assessment Center, where business owners can receive guidance and support in completing their applications. This initiative aims to help local businesses recover from the economic impact of disasters, ensuring they have the resources needed to rebuild and thrive.
Eligible businesses can apply for low-interest loans to cover operational costs, repair damages, and restore their establishments. The SBA encourages all affected business owners to take advantage of this opportunity, as these loans can be vital for recovery and long-term sustainability.
As the deadline approaches, business owners are urged to gather necessary documentation and visit the center for assistance in navigating the application process. This support is a significant step toward revitalizing the local economy and fostering resilience in the face of adversity.
